.Net 标准版 .Net core 2.2

Posted

技术标签:

【中文标题】.Net 标准版 .Net core 2.2【英文标题】:.Net standard version for .Net core 2.2 【发布时间】:2019-06-20 12:59:03 【问题描述】:

用 Google 搜索了一下,但找不到 .Net core 2.2 的 .Net 标准版本。我得到的唯一版本是,

有什么提示吗?

【问题讨论】:

可能值得一读,看看这是否能提供任何见解。有一些关于向后兼容性问题的讨论github.com/dotnet/standard/issues/833 在此讨论 .net 标准 2.1 与 .net 核心 2.1。我不确定 2.2 的支持是什么。 docs.microsoft.com/en-us/dotnet/standard/… 可惜只看了表格,却忽略了表格下方的所有说明。 接近的选民要么没有正确阅读这个问题,要么完全不知道这个问题是关于什么的。密切的原因在这里根本没有意义。 【参考方案1】:

正如您在上传的表格中看到的那样,.NET Standard 2.0 是最新的可用版本,并且完全受 .NET Core v2.0 支持。正如您在此发布文档中看到的那样。部分,.NET Standard 2.1 将支持 .NET Core 3.0 和 .NET Core 2.2。对于整个页面检查here。

在我看来,如果你不处理极端的事情(我的意思是最近添加的 .NET Core 的部分),你可以使用 .NET Standard 2.0。这可能会产生一些错误,但仍然值得一试。

【讨论】:

fully supoorts .NET Core v2.0 - 我认为反过来。 .NET Core 2.0 支持/实现 .NET Standard. @Fabio 反之亦然适用。但是你说的更有意义。

以上是关于.Net 标准版 .Net core 2.2的主要内容,如果未能解决你的问题,请参考以下文章

面向 .NET 标准的 Azure 函数显示警告

.net core 2.2 和广泛开放的 CORS

从 2.2 .Net core 迁移到 3.0 Cors 错误

CORS预检请求被阻止.Net Core 2.2 [重复]

ASP.NET 核心 CORS 标头未显示

如何为 ASP.NET Core 2.2 项目中的子域正确启用 CORS?